Output fe4726648560ddd131e578471b04319330aa4c7cc56782f96bfc38b5fc6eaa1e:17

value
43993102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afdded66476189ac8e745c55f7f3363bd74038af OP_EQUAL
address
MPw4LnLmGeqYGmKatyqAvYsdUEb1M4KKTF
transaction
fe4726648560ddd131e578471b04319330aa4c7cc56782f96bfc38b5fc6eaa1e
spent
true